Brand age and franchise-program age are different facts. The first date marks the operating concept’s history; the second marks when the system began selling franchises. Capriotti’s says it opened in Wilmington in 1976, while its franchise program began in 1991. Wienerschnitzel’s official history dates the first hot-dog stand to 1961; the dataset records franchising from 1965. Those gaps describe years in which a format may have developed before outside operators joined.

A short gap does not prove haste, and a long gap does not prove a better franchise. The legal franchisor may be newer than the consumer brand, a company may acquire and relaunch an older concept, or an international operator may enter the United States decades after opening elsewhere. The dates need Item 1 context before they can support a conclusion.

What longevity can and cannot show

Surviving through many lease cycles and consumer shifts is meaningful operating history. It is not evidence that the current agreement, current leadership or current unit economics resemble an earlier period. A 1960s founding date does not make a 2024 fee schedule old, and a familiar name does not replace review of the current disclosure.

Young systems deserve the same discipline in the other direction. Limited history means fewer renewal cycles, transfers and closures are available to inspect. It does not by itself establish fraud or failure. Item 20’s outlet movement, Item 21’s audited franchisor financial statements, litigation in Item 3 and conversations with current and former franchisees add evidence that a founding year cannot.

The table is sorted by the brand’s founded year. “Franchising since” is listed separately, and a missing date is left blank rather than inferred from a press release or the age of the franchisor entity. Headquarters is the location in the source behind the row, not necessarily the place where the menu concept first appeared.

Unit counts retain their own measurement year. That means the age and size columns sometimes describe different snapshots, just as a 2023 filing and a 2026 filing do. Follow the profile to see the stated source before comparing two rows. This ranking answers “which documented concept is older?” It does not answer “which franchise is safer?” or “which one will perform better?”
